      <description>&lt;P&gt;The following worked for me.&amp;nbsp; Although there appears to be only the option of changing the default spline vertex drag-type, it worked for initial type too.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;For Max 2023, open the file &lt;STRONG&gt;CurrentDefaults.ini&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;for my installation it was located at: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;C:\Users\YOURNAME\AppData\Local\Autodesk\3dsMax\2023 - 64bit\ENU\en-US\defaults\MAX&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;(substitute your user name for YOURNAME)&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Search the file for DefaultDragType and change the value to 1.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="leeminardi_0-1677338025204.png" style="width: 600px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://forums.autodesk.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/1181273iBB8E91BA68FF0031/image-size/medium?v=v2&amp;amp;px=400" role="button" title="leeminardi_0-1677338025204.png" alt="leeminardi_0-1677338025204.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
